The Evolution of Health Wearables

Health wearables have come a long way since their inception. Early devices were simple step counters. Today, pulse watches are at the forefront of this evolution. They offer a wide range of health monitoring features.

Pulse watches can now track heart rate, sleep patterns, and even stress levels. The technology has become more accurate and user-friendly over time. Many people now rely on these devices for daily health insights.

The market for health wearables has grown rapidly. Pulse watches are now a common sight on wrists everywhere. They've become an essential tool for those seeking to improve their health and fitness.

Key Features of Pulse Watch

Pulse watches offer a variety of features that make them valuable health tools. Here are some key features:

  • Continuous heart rate monitoring
  • Sleep tracking and analysis
  • Stress level detection
  • Activity and exercise tracking
  • GPS for outdoor activities
  • Blood oxygen level measurement
  • ECG capabilities (in some models)

These features allow users to get a comprehensive view of their health. They can track their fitness progress and monitor vital signs. Some pulse watches even offer guided breathing exercises for stress relief.

Many models are water-resistant, making them suitable for swimming. They often have long battery life, lasting days or even weeks on a single charge.

Comparing Pulse Watch with Other Health Devices

Pulse watches offer unique advantages over other health devices. Unlike traditional fitness trackers, they provide more detailed health data. They're more convenient than separate heart rate monitors or blood pressure cuffs.

Compared to smartphones, pulse watches are always with the user. They can track health data 24/7. This constant monitoring allows for more accurate and comprehensive health insights.

However, pulse watches may not be as accurate as medical-grade devices for some measurements. They're best used as a complementary tool to professional medical care. They can help users stay aware of their health trends and potential issues.

How Pulse Watches Are Changing Lifestyle Tracking

Pulse watches are revolutionizing how people track their daily habits. They provide real-time feedback on physical activity, sleep, and stress levels. This immediate data encourages users to make healthier choices throughout the day.

For example, a pulse watch might remind you to move if you've been sitting too long. It can show how your heart rate changes during different activities. This information helps users understand how their lifestyle affects their health.

Many people use pulse watches to set and achieve fitness goals. The devices can track progress over time. This motivates users to stick to their health plans and celebrate their achievements.

The Impact of Pulse Watches on Wellness Programs

Wellness programs are increasingly incorporating pulse watches. These devices provide valuable data for both individuals and program administrators. They allow for more personalized health recommendations and interventions.

Companies are using pulse watches in employee wellness programs. They can encourage healthy competition and team-building through step challenges. Some insurance companies offer discounts for users who meet certain health goals tracked by pulse watches.

Healthcare providers are also using data from pulse watches. It helps them monitor patients' health between visits. This can lead to earlier detection of health issues and more effective treatment plans.

Integration of AI and Machine Learning in Pulse Watch Monitoring

Artificial intelligence (AI) and machine learning are enhancing the capabilities of pulse watches. These technologies can analyze large amounts of health data to identify patterns and trends.

AI can provide personalized health insights based on a user's data. For example, it might suggest the best times for exercise based on sleep patterns and stress levels. It can also predict potential health issues before they become serious.

Machine learning algorithms are improving the accuracy of pulse watch measurements. They can filter out noise and artifacts in the data. This leads to more reliable health tracking over time.

Regulatory and Ethical Considerations of Pulse Watch Devices in the United States

Understanding the Regulatory Environment for Health Wearables

The regulatory landscape for health wearables in the US is complex. The FDA classifies most pulse watches as low-risk devices. This means they don't require the same rigorous approval process as medical devices.

However, as pulse watches add more advanced health features, regulations may change. Some features, like ECG capabilities, may require FDA clearance. Companies must balance innovation with regulatory compliance.

There are ongoing discussions about how to regulate health data from wearables. This includes ensuring the accuracy of measurements and protecting user privacy.

Ethical Implications of Wearable Technology in Healthcare

The use of pulse watches raises several ethical questions. One concern is the potential for overreliance on these devices. Users might delay seeking medical care if they trust their pulse watch data too much.

There's also the issue of health inequality. Not everyone can afford or access pulse watches. This could lead to disparities in health monitoring and preventive care.

Privacy is another major ethical concern. Pulse watches collect sensitive health data. There are debates about who should have access to this data and how it should be used.

The Future of Data Privacy and Security in Pulse Watch Ecosystems

As pulse watches collect more health data, protecting this information becomes crucial. Companies are implementing stronger security measures to safeguard user data. This includes encryption and secure cloud storage.

There are ongoing efforts to give users more control over their health data. Many pulse watch apps now allow users to choose what data to share and with whom. Some companies are exploring blockchain technology to enhance data security and transparency.

The future may bring new regulations on health data privacy. This could impact how pulse watch companies collect, store, and use user information. Balancing innovation with privacy protection will be an ongoing challenge in this field.
